📍 Historical Context of Young Woman in White Reading

Work: Young Woman in White Reading
Artist: Auguste Renoir
Year: 1873
Museum: National Gallery of Ireland
Dimensions: 27 x 35 cm

Created in 1873, the painting "Young Woman in White Reading" is emblematic of the Impressionist movement, an artistic current that revolutionized the way to capture light and movement. Located in Dublin, within the prestigious National Gallery of Ireland, this work is a vibrant testimony to the art and culture of the 19th century, a period when the contributions of light and color were asserted as essential in the pictorial composition.

📖 Scene Depicted in Young Woman in White Reading

This painting depicts a young woman sitting, wrapped in a white dress, absorbed in a book. The choice of light color reflects purity and innocence, while the soft light surrounding her evokes an atmosphere of calm and concentration. Through this canvas, Renoir invites us to feel the peace of a moment of reading, on a beautiful sunny day.
